Klappentext Horrific, horrendous, unspeakable, the Whitechapel murderer, Jack the Ripper, stalked the streets of East London in 1888, slaughtering prostitutes and bewildering the police who were hunting him. This book looks at the evidence left by the murderer. Zusammenfassung Horrific! horrendous! unspeakable! the Whitechapel murderer!
